About alma:
Therapy has the power to improve lives, relationships, and the world we live in.
Still, accessing the positive potential of this work is often complicated—it’s hard to find the right therapist, scary to overcome the stigma of asking for help, and most therapy spaces don’t feel like the kind of protected environment where care can flourish.
We exist to elevate the therapy experience and to positively contribute to the conversation about the value of therapy.
We build co-working communities for top-quality therapists. Our members are empowered to deliver amazing care through access to beautifully designed office space, best-in-class technology, and a community of colleagues for referral opportunities, training, and support.
Our first NYC location will open in September 2018.
What is this position?
We are looking for a mission-driven, strategically-minded team member who will be responsible for owning critical finance, operations, and expansion responsibilities for our business. This person will also play an important role in setting the overall direction and strategy of our business.
Responsibilities include:
- Long-term business planning, analysis and modeling of expansion opportunities, financials and competitive positioning, helping make key decisions around pricing strategy and plan designs
- Actively participate in preparing material for regular board meetings and investor updates
- Comprehensive quantitative and qualitative assessment of growth initiatives, including new locations, business lines, revenue models, partnerships, distribution channels
- Understanding and benchmarking of operational levers and KPIs, such as unit economics, customer lifetime value and customer acquisition costs
- Build the infrastructure and team to manage day-to-day financial operations
- Development and execution of our capital strategy and capital structure solutions including equity, debt and other opportunities
- Be a “general athlete” on the team picking up workstreams across the business as needed
